FAQs on Basics of Ecology Video Lecture - Famous Books for UPSC Exam (Summary & Tests)

1. What is ecology?
Ans. Ecology is the study of the relationships between organisms and their environment, including the interactions between living organisms and their physical surroundings.
2. Why is ecology important?
Ans. Ecology is important because it helps us understand how ecosystems function, how different species interact with each other, and how human activities can impact the environment.
3. What are the levels of ecological organization?
Ans. The levels of ecological organization range from individual organisms to populations, communities, ecosystems, and the biosphere.
4. How do biotic and abiotic factors influence ecosystems?
Ans. Biotic factors are living organisms that affect an ecosystem, while abiotic factors are non-living components like temperature, water, and sunlight that also play a crucial role in shaping ecosystems.
5. How can individuals contribute to ecology conservation efforts?
Ans. Individuals can contribute to ecology conservation efforts by reducing their carbon footprint, supporting conservation initiatives, practicing sustainable living habits, and spreading awareness about the importance of protecting the environment.
